CPL Theory for the CPL Flight test Oral component questions with correct answers
Privileges and Limitations of a Commercial Pilot's license - correct answer ⦁ To pilot, as pilot in command, any aircraft in any private or commercial operation, other than: ⦁ a multi‑crew aircraft in a charter or regular public transport operation; or ⦁ an aeroplane certified for single‑pilot operation, that has a maximum certificated take‑off weight of more than 5700 kg, in a regular public transport operation; or ⦁ a turbojet aeroplane with a maximum certificated take‑off weight of more than 3500 kg in a regular public transport operation; and The holder of a commercial pilot licence is authorised to exercise the privileges of the licence in a multi-crew operation only if the holder has completed an approved course of training in multi-crew cooperation.
